Benefits of a Wireless Burglar Alarm

Defense, safety, and the ability for you to relax are all things a wireless burglar alarm in your home can provide. A wireless burglar alarm offers many benefits for all households no matter where you live or the value of your belongings. Since break-ins can occur anywhere at any time and in only seconds, securing your home should be a top priority.

The common misconceptions about wireless burglar alarms are that they are complicated, expensive, and unnecessary. A lot of people feel that a wireless burglar alarm is unaffordable. But a wireless burglar alarm is affordable for most people, and it often ultimately saves money by lowering the price of homeowners insurance. Professional installation of a wireless system does not have to cost thousands of dollars; the majority of security companies will install one for a few hundred dollars.

Purchasing a wireless burglar alarm and installing it yourself can save you money. You only need to place window and door contacts and plug the control panel into the phone jack and your wireless burglar alarm will be completely installed. Next, you can choose whether or not your system will be monitored remotely by a monitoring company, which can also be very inexpensive, not costing any more than any other utility bill, possibly even less.

Most people think that it is not necessary to have wireless burglar alarms. A lot of people have the preconceived notion that, if they reside in an ordinary home and not in a “rich neighborhood,” their home will not be burglarized. This is false. Often a burglary will occur because the house does not have an alarm and is the easier target. Yes, even if it is a small home or not in a wealthy community, your home is a target for a robbery.

Another common misconception is that a burglar will not stop if there is an alarm. But as homes with alarm systems are more difficult to break into, most burglars try and avoid them. Most burglars pick out the first house that appears to have easier access, since the majority of the burglars are not professionals but opportunists. If there is an easier house to break into elsewhere, they will quickly bypass the house with the alarm system.

Though some people think that, by cutting wires, a burglar can easily disarm an alarm system, that scenario doesn't come into play with a wireless burglar alarm. Likewise, there are others who feel that, rather than being a deterrent, installing a wireless burglar alarm will instead make their property seem more valuable, more in need of protecting, and thereby more attractive to burglars. Once again, a thief is not very confident and will choose the less challenging house to break into.

The burglar alarm increases safety. Since even average homes have TVs, appliances, movies, games, cable boxes, and other belongings regularly sought after by burglars, having a burglar alarm does not indicate that you have valuable property. Any home, even those with ordinary belongings, can benefit from a wireless burglar alarm.
